CVE-2022-43763: Lack of checking preconditions in APROL
Insufficient check of preconditions could lead to Denial of Service conditions when calling commands on the Tbase server of B&R APROL versions < R 4.2-07.

What is CVE-2022-43763?
CVE-2022-43763 is a vulnerability that allows attackers to cause a denial of service (DoS) by exploiting insufficient checks of preconditions when calling commands on the Tbase server of B&R APROL versions prior to R 4.2-07.
What is the severity of CVE-2022-43763?
The severity of CVE-2022-43763 is high, with a CVSS score of 7.5.
Which software versions are affected by CVE-2022-43763?
CVE-2022-43763 affects B&R APROL versions prior to R 4.2-07.
How can I fix the CVE-2022-43763 vulnerability?
To fix the CVE-2022-43763 vulnerability, it is recommended to update your B&R APROL software to version R 4.2-07 or later.
